  • 7 Benefits babies and children thrive on a routine
    Many parents don't want to have routine or a strict schedule because they don't like to feel chained to following it every day and some mums feel a little stressed thinking “gosh if baby needs to nap at 10am what happens if they don't, it's more relaxed to just go with the flow…we prefer to follow baby's cues...” While it is easier sometimes to go with the flow because of the sense of freedom, many babies struggle with that.   • My 3 favorite swaddles
    I often hear parents report that their baby is like Houdini and performs the most amazing escape act and they just don’t seem to like the swaddle so they stop using it, after many attempts and purchasing many different brands. My take on this is that often those swaddles are either not the right size or more often have not been wrapped correctly. If your baby can get out of it then it was too loose. Now I will caveat that by saying it cant be too tight and legs need to be free to lay in the “froggy” position” to avoid hip dysplasia.
